A row crop header is a specialized harvesting attachment designed to efficiently gather and prepare corn or other row crops for collection. The Capello Quasar F8 Row Crop Header is a modern example of this equipment category, built to integrate with compatible combine harvesters for mechanized grain and forage harvest operations.
This 2022 model is configured as an eight-row corn head with 30-inch row spacing. The unit features chopping capability, allowing it to process crop material during harvest. The header is equipped with green poly components and fender augers to facilitate material flow and handling. It includes Headsight AHHC (Automatic Header Height Control) technology, which automatically manages cutting height during operation for consistent performance and material quality.
The machine is supplied with interchangeable header kits available for John Deere, Gleaner, and Case IH combine platforms, providing flexibility for integration with equipment from multiple manufacturers. The header is in used condition and is located in Ohio, USA.
